Transaction 32be54e154e7f82233e88bc49a25580b4b7cdb82f89b3b8ef7039d265fea1b29

1 Input
2 Outputs
  • 32be54e154e7f82233e88bc49a25580b4b7cdb82f89b3b8ef7039d265fea1b29:0
  • value  1177418
    address  1AfqVgDffuotX4tWSGAkwF8m4xik5gZfZd
  • 32be54e154e7f82233e88bc49a25580b4b7cdb82f89b3b8ef7039d265fea1b29:1
  • value  42345278
    address  3PdCWKeAvC8LKoGJGSoAzYR1SxueqtP3rm